Specific embodiment
In order to describe the technical content, the structural feature, the achieved object and the effect of this invention in detail, below in conjunction with embodiment And attached drawing is cooperated to be explained in detail.
Embodiment
Please refer to Fig. 1 to Fig. 7, a kind of security protection lighting integrated road lamp system, including human body monitoring module, camera module, Identification of Images module, lamp group drive module, power management module, battery, lamp group state monitoring module, communication module, solar energy Power supply module and control module, the control module respectively with human body monitoring module, Identification of Images module, power management module, Communication module is connected with lamp group drive module, the camera module respectively with the human body monitoring module and Identification of Images module Connection, the power management module is electrically connected with the solar powered module, battery and city respectively, the lamp group respectively with institute Lamp group drive module to be stated to connect with lamp group state monitoring module, the lamp group state monitoring module is connect with camera module,
The human body monitoring module exports someone's id signal and starting camera letter for receiving external human body sensing Number;The camera module is used to obtain the portrait data of predeterminable area, and is sent to Identification of Images module;The Identification of Images Module exports stranger's signal for comparing portrait data with portrait data are prestored;The lamp group drive module is used for Lamp group is driven according to the light controling signal of control module;
The control module is used to control the output mode of lamp group drive module adjustment lamp group, and the control module includes dodging Lamp alarm unit, the flashing light alarm unit are used to export warning control signal to lamp group drive module according to alarm signal.
The power management module is connect with the control module and battery respectively, and the power management module includes battery Electric power detection unit and switch unit, the battery capacity detection unit are used to detect the capacity status of battery, and the switching is single Member is for switching battery power supply or mains-supplied.
The lamp group state monitoring module is used to detect the working condition of lamp group and status data is sent to camera mould Block.
The communication module is connect with the control module, and the communication module is used for by system access internet, with cloud End server interacts.
The solar powered module is for it will be seen that light is converted into electric energy and is system power supply.
Specifically, referring to Fig. 6, MCU 1 be connected separately with communication module circuit 2, storage circuit 3, indicator light circuit 4, Human body monitoring modular circuit 5, camera module circuit 6, lamp group current sampling and current foldback circuit 8, MOSFET pipe 9, battery Sample circuit 11, solar energy conversion circuit 12, solar energy sample circuit 13 and mains hybrid circuit 14, camera module circuit with Human body monitoring modular circuit and electric quantity monitoring modular circuit 7 connect, and camera module is connect by voltage conversion circuit with battery, MCU is powered by system power supply circuit.
When human body monitoring modular circuit 5 (PIR) detects someone in range, the starting output of human body monitoring modular circuit 5 Lamp group is changed to normal power light illumination mode, while camera by high level 3.3V to MCU 1 and camera module circuit 6, MCU 1 Modular circuit starting, is taken pictures with rear camera by built-in process control, and picture data is sent to Identification of Images module (not indicating in figure), Identification of Images module identify the portrait in picture data, make with portrait data are preset in database It compares, is mismatched when presetting portrait data in the portrait and database in photo, Identification of Images module then issues to MCU 1 strange People's signal, MCU 1 realize the control of dark mode bright to lamp group by adjusting the on-off frequency of MOSFET pipe 9, to realize that lamp dodges Alarm function;If presetting portrait Data Matching in the portrait and database in photo, lamp group keeps normal power light illumination mode, directly No longer someone is detected in range to human body monitoring modular circuit 5, then lamp group is changed to low power illumination mode by MCU.
When human body monitoring modular circuit 5 never detects dynamic mode, human body monitoring module electricity in reconnaissance range It is low level 0V, camera module circuit 6 that road, which keeps the corresponding interface of output low level 0V, MCU 1 and camera module circuit 6, Then silent status is kept to be failure to actuate with Identification of Images module, realizes low-power consumption running.
Storage circuit 3 is preferably EEPROM, and the EEPROM is used to store the control program of MCU 1;Communication module circuit 2 For facilitating user remotely to monitor and operate for system access internet, while portrait data can be uploaded to server end knowledge Not, the complexity of road lamp system is reduced, computational burden is mitigated;Indicator light circuit 4 is used for display system current working state, side Just the quick positioning failure of maintenance personal;Lamp group current sampling and current foldback circuit 8 are used to detect the operating current of lamp group, and Circuit is protected when failure;Battery sampling circuit 11 is used to sample the reference voltage of battery-end;Solar energy sample circuit 13 is used In the reference voltage of sampling photovoltaic solar panel;Solar energy conversion circuit is used to make by the working condition for adjusting electrical module Photovoltaic panel can export more electric energy, and the direct current that solar panel issues effectively is stored in the battery;Mains hybrid Circuit 14 is for switching mains-supplied or battery power supply.
Referring to Fig. 7, positive pole is connected to the positive terminal of first capacitor C1, the positive terminal of first capacitor C1 is connected to electricity Feel one end of L1, the other end of inductance L1 is connected to the drain electrode of field-effect tube Q1, and the drain electrode of field-effect tube Q1 is connected to diode One end of D1, the other end of diode D1 are connect with the anode of the second capacitor C2, the anode and the anode of lamp group of the second capacitor C2 Connection, the cathode of power supply and the cathode of first capacitor connect, and the cathode of first capacitor C1 is connect with the source electrode of field-effect tube Q1, field The source electrode of effect pipe Q1 is connect with the cathode of the second capacitor C2, and the cathode of the second capacitor C2 is connect with one end of current-limiting resistance R1, The other end of current-limiting resistance R1 and the cathode of lamp group connect, and the cathode of the second capacitor C2 is also connected to ground, the grid of field-effect tube Q1 Pole is connect with MCU.In the present embodiment, system is from battery electricity-taking.
When needing lamp to dodge alarm function, MCU passes through the Boost DC/DC in preset process control lamp group drive module Circuit carries out periodic on/off control to the grid of MOSFET pipe 9, to change power supply to the frequency of the output electric current of lamp group Rate and amplitude act lamp group according to the light on and off of certain frequency, can be different to realize by changing the crystal oscillator clocking capability of MCU Switching frequency, as 0.5S opens the/pass 0.5S.
System further includes electric quantity monitoring modular circuit 7, and electric quantity monitoring modular circuit 7 is sampled by battery plus-negative plate both ends, obtained Current battery level is compared the voltage for taking battery with the reference voltage V1 in electric quantity monitoring modular circuit, determines battery Voltage status, when being lower than reference voltage V1, electric quantity monitoring modular circuit 7 exports high level signal (such as 3.3V signal), works as height When reference voltage V1, electric quantity monitoring modular circuit 7 exports low level signal (such as 0V signal), and MCU 1 is by receiving the level Signal knows battery capacity status.
When current battery level is lower than reference voltage V1, system is switched to alternating current operating mode, power management mould by MCU 1 Block circuit 7 uses alternating current for LED module power supply, and charges the battery processing simultaneously.
Lamp group state monitoring module alarm lamp working condition, lamp by way of detecting the end voltage under lamp group working condition State detection module accesses 12V power supply, while obtaining the end voltage V2 of lamp group in the operating condition, drives light by field-effect tube Coupled switch work can then drive optocoupler combination switch when lamp group voltage is within the scope of normal working voltage;When lamp group voltage is low In normal working voltage, then optocoupler combination switch cannot be driven;Lamp state detection module by the current regime of Cutoff current, thus Output high level or low level signal, camera module identify the working condition of current lamp group by the level signal.

Referring to Fig. 8, the invention further relates to a kind of control methods of security protection lighting integrated road lamp system, including walk as follows It is rapid:
Whether someone is movable for S1, detection current region, is then to enter normal power light illumination mode, and enter step S2;
Human body monitoring module carries out intermittent scanning to current monitored area, when detecting someone, i.e., to control module and taking the photograph As head module transmission corresponding signal, control module control lamp group enters normal power light illumination mode, while camera module starts.
Portrait data in S2, acquisition region;
Camera module is taken pictures or is imaged to current monitored area, to obtain still photo or dynamic video, and therefrom Obtain portrait data.
S3, the portrait data that prestore of portrait data and database are compared, if prestoring portrait data not with database Matching, then enter step S4;
Portrait data are parsed, and are compared with the portrait data that prestore in database, database can be from being locally stored mould It is transferred in block, can also be obtained by communication module from cloud server, portrait data can also be uploaded to cloud server, It is compared in server beyond the clouds.
S4, lamp group enter alert mode, and continuing to test current region, whether someone is movable, if not detecting physical activity, Then enter low power illumination mode, returns to step S1.
When the portrait data that prestore in the portrait data and database that the discovery of Identification of Images module obtains mismatch, then to control Molding block sends warning instruction, and control module control lamp group enters alert mode, and the light on and off of lamp group interval are to play a warning role.Together When, human body monitoring module continues to carry out intermittent scanning to current monitored area, when the people detected in region leaves, i.e., to control Module and camera module send corresponding signal, and control module control lamp group enters low-power output mode.
Further, before step S1, further include the steps that obtaining environment bright information, if environment bright information is lower than Preset value then enters low power illumination mode.
In the present embodiment, when environment light is excessively bright, illustrate not needing to illuminate for daytime at this time, when environment brightness is got off, be lower than When default brightness threshold values, illustrate to enter night, control module starts human body monitoring module at this time, and according to human body monitoring module Signal enter associative mode.
